I use imap.googlemail.com for my gmail imap server, but that won't make
any difference. I've just tested, and it appears that gmail/googlemail
is now forcing SSL. I.e., neither imap.gmail.com nor imap.googlemail.com
is answering port 143 connects, but both work with SSL on port 993.

The next time you receive a post from the list in question, view the
source (More -> View Source in Thunderbird). If you don't see the List-*
headers, copy ALL of the headers and post them here. You can munge any
personal info if you like.
